Villian Stats (VPIP/PFR/AF): 43/14/1

Hi guys this is a hand where I was trying to turn KK into a bluff. I don't have much info on villain since I just sat down at this table.

Hero (MP2) $9.85 - VP:20 PFR:20 AF:2.0 W:100|0 STL:0| 3B:0| CB:100| N:-5.92 Hands:5

Villain (CO) $10.28 - VP:43 PFR:14 AF:1.0 W:67|100 STL:0| 3B:0| CB:100|0 N:6.27 Hands:7



Pre Flop: Hero (MP2) with K:spade: K:club:

P4(MP1) calls 0.10, Hero(MP2) raises 0.40, Villain (CO) calls 0.40, P7(BTN) folds, P8(SB) folds, P9(BB) folds, P4(MP1) calls 0.30


Flop: T:diamond: 3:heart: 9:diamond: (3 players)

P4(MP1) checks, Hero(MP2) bets 0.80, Villain (LP) calls 0.80, P4(MP1) folds


Turn: 8:club: (2 players)

Hero(MP1) checks, Villain(MP2) bets 1.57, Hero (MP1) calls 1.57


River: A:diamond: (2 players)

Hero(MP1) bets 3


Like I mentioned earlier I don't have much info on villain but his range given his flop call and turn bet consists of 2 pair hands, sets, QJo, QJs. I didn't feel like flush draws were in his range given the action so I tried representing the flush and value bluffing my KK.

Why didn't you bet the turn? You'll get so much more value/information than check-calling.

Like I mentioned earlier I don't have much info on villain but his range given his flop call and turn bet consists of 2 pair hands, sets, QJo, QJs. I didn't feel like flush draws were in his range given the action so I tried representing the flush and value bluffing my KK.

That's a pretty strong range... he could have floated you with A high, second pair, etc. Also, if you put him on such a strong range, why would you try to bluff him? Just c-f river and wait for a better spot/better read.

I also prefer here bet the turn. Maybe then he would fold on the turn. When you check on the turn, you have still strong hand, but you lose initiative, so better bet the turn.
River - it isn't good card for me, on this board I probably check and hope that he also checks. If he bets, I probably fold, because I'm afraid of ace or flush.
As played - bet on the river, it seems even good, sometimes it works.
